    fml.  Having just received a new 5dm2, and having some concerns about some its features compared to the other cameras out there, i see this today.

    http://www.dpreview.com/previews/canoneos7d/

    New AF system.. check.
    New metering system. check.
    Wireless flash (i don’t know if this is really wireless or not, but it says it is, so i’ll run with it) check.
    18 mp. check
    8 fps. check

    Not to mention a whole host of other features, including a fully customizable user interface where about every button is programmable, new viewfinder, and the list goes on.

    Wow.

    I guess i need to decide how much i really like the 5d2 now, because this seems like a heck of a camera, with real features that make a upgrade legitimately worthwhile.

     Why canon doesn’t let the MP war go, and put one of these things out at 12-14 mp with great image quality is beyond me.

    Marketing. The laymen will automatically think that higher MP number means better quality. Thats why you see point and shoot cameras at 12+ MP right now. It’s a feature that the public has grabbed onto to relate to image quality.

    I don’t quite agree because provided your lens is sharp enough to deal with the extra resolution, a higher pixel count will render more detail.
    Obviously, more detail won’t always make your picture ‘better’, but in a lot of situations, like landscapes or a fish portrait it could add a lot to the quality.
    (IMHO)

    It should also be noted that $1600 is pretty cheap for that level of resolution compared to even a couple years back.
